Pta California Congress Of Patents Teachers & Students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 66,567 | 55,005 | 11,562 | 10.9 | — |
| 2013 | 64,167 | 71,655 | −7,488 | 7.1 | — |
| 2014 | 58,245 | 55,141 | 3,104 | 9.9 | — |
| 2015 | 60,671 | 48,204 | 12,467 | 14.5 | — |
| 2016 | 65,336 | 64,617 | 719 | 10.9 | — |
| 2017 | 76,292 | 42,908 | 33,384 | 25.8 | — |
| 2018 | 53,009 | 51,819 | 1,190 | 21.6 | — |
| 2019 | 64,840 | 95,562 | −30,722 | 7.9 | — |
| 2020 | 73,695 | 49,922 | 23,773 | 20.7 | — |
| 2021 | 64,328 | 82,847 | −18,519 | 9.8 | — |
| 2022 | 35,352 | 53,530 | −18,178 | 11.1 | — |
| 2023 | 43,228 | 59,267 | −16,039 | 6.8 | — |
| 2024 | 106,121 | 58,878 | 47,243 | 16.5 | — |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ization brought in $47,243 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 16.5 months of spending, up from 10.9 in 2012.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
